Risto-Pekka Blom

Risto-Pekka BLOM (Finland) completed a technical study, but never felt the motivation to start a career as a technician. For a few years, he moved regularly while trying to find the goal in his life. At the age of 27, he started a course in Audiovisual Media and Expression and finally found his passion. After an education in Art and Media, he became a maker of video art and experimental short films. By now, his work has been shown in more than 20 countries.

Filmography

(all short) Kalataksi (1999), Piikit (2000), Piste/Dot (2002), Tätä et oppinut koulussa/This One You Didn’t Learn in School (2003), Huoneesta toiseen/From One Room to Another (2003), Ryytimaa/Vegetable Garden (2004), Gepardi on valoa nopeampi/Cheetah Is Faster than Light (2004), Storm (2006), Pingpong (2006), En koskaan sanonut/Words Never Spoken (2009), Mitä kuuluu./What's Up. (2009), Paska isä/Crap Dad (2013), Kurdrjavka - Pikku kippura/Kudravka - Little Ball of Fur (2013)
